POSITION SUMMARY
Position Summary:
The IT Network Technician Foreman is responsible for leading, coaching and mentoring the network technician team in installing, configuring, and maintaining physical and logical network infrastructure, such as Local Area Networks (LAN), WideArea Networks (WAN) cabling, facilities and underground fiber optics, including data closet and data center hardware connectivity. The network technician foreman oversees projects, follows and enforces safety protocols, troubleshoots complex system issues, and provides technical support and guidance to the network technician team to meet deadlines. Oversees the installation, termination, labeling, and testing of fiber optic and copper cabling, patch panels, and racks. The network technician foreman follows the technical standards and organizational policies and procedures relating to the SRHC infrastructure. Performs underground fiber locates and participates in a network technician on-call rotation. Provides a strong background in LAN/WAN's hardware, and connectivity. Manages material procurement, tracks project progress, and ensures deadlines are met. Coaches and trains a crew of technicians to ensure high-quality standards, efficient installations and maintenance.
POSITION QUALIFICATIONS
Minimum Education High School or equivalent. Minimum Experience Four years working as an IT technician in a medium to large organization or health care facility.
